Security Bulletin: IBM Maximo Spatial Asset Management is vulnerable to cross-site request forgery (CVE-2020-4651)

Security Bulletin


Summary

IBM Maximo Spatial Asset Management is vulnerable to cross-site request forgery which could allow an attacker to execute malicious and unauthorized actions transmitted from a user that the website trusts.

Vulnerability Details

CVEID:   CVE-2020-4651
DESCRIPTION:   IBM Maximo Spatial Asset Management is vulnerable to cross-site request forgery which could allow an attacker to execute malicious and unauthorized actions transmitted from a user that the website trusts.
CVSS Base score: 4.8
CVSS Temporal Score: See: https://exchange.xforce.ibmcloud.com/vulnerabilities/186024 for the current score.
C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.0/AV:A/AC:H/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:N/I:H/A:N)

Affected Products and Versions

Affected Product(s)Version(s)
IBM Maximo Spatial Asset Management7.6
